About the role

  • Collaborate with teams to identify opportunities for technology and AI to improve business processes.
  • Prototype and test solutions using tools like ChatGPT and Microsoft Copilot Studio.
  • Explore and apply emerging technologies to solve real-world challenges.
  • Translate technical possibilities into practical outcomes for stakeholders.
  • Stay informed about trends in AI, automation, and digital innovation.
  • Support planning and strategy efforts with a technology-forward mindset.

Requirements

  • 3-5 years of experience in technology consulting or innovation-focused roles.
  • Comfortable experimenting with new platforms and tools.
  • Some programming experience (e.g., Python, JavaScript, or similar).
  • Strong problem-solving and analytical skills.
  • Ability to learn quickly and work in ambiguous environments.
  • Excellent communication and collaboration abilities.
Benefits
  • Competitive health, dental, and vision coverage, HSA and FSA accounts, life and disability insurance, fertility and family planning benefits, and employee assistance and discount programs
  • 11 paid federal holidays and flexible unlimited time off (UTO)
  • Generous 401(k) matching with immediate vesting
